Approach

I practice primarily from a psychoanalytically informed approach. I am also trained in Dialectical Behavioural Therapy (DBT), and at times integrate these skills-based interventions to support emotional regulation and day-to-day coping. While I believe coping skills are essential for functioning effectively, my passion lies in working more deeply with feelings, personal histories, and relational patterns in order to better understand what may be operating unconsciously in our lives. Exploring the meanings behind our patterns and the defences we enact can help us develop greater insight into how we engage with ourselves and others, allowing us to live in ways that feel more present, thoughtful, and effective. I also believe that individuals cannot be understood in isolation from the social and relational worlds they inhabit. I consider it deeply important to acknowledge and validate the different intersectionalities of identity, privilege, and marginalisation that shape our experiences. My work is therefore attentive to racial, gender, LGBTQIA+, and neurodivergent identities, and to the ways these experiences may inform psychological distress, relationships, and ways of being in the world.
